THE EFFECTS OF SOME TRAETMENTS ON YIELD AND QUALITY OF DWARF CAVENDISH BANANA CLONE

Hamide GÜBBÜK 1 ,Mustafa PEKMEZCİ 2

Viewed : 1187 - Downloaded : 573 In this research effects of male bud removal an urea applications after bunch emerged, on bunch weight and fruit quality were investigated in Dwarf Cavendish banana clone. Both applications were conducted after the bunch emerged and female bud on the fingers dried out. While in some applications only male bud was removed, in some applications 10, 15,20 g urea replaced into bags which were attached to last hand by giving 10 cm distance. The experimental results showed that removal of male bud and urea treatments increased bunch weight and fuit quality. There was no significiant differences among applications in terms of soluble solid content. The best result in terms of bunch weight and fruit quality was observed in 20 g urea application. Keywords :
